Summary / Abstract (Note) | IN THE first decades of the 21st century, the US experienced several major socioeconomic shocks - primarily the so-called great recession of 2008-2009, the most destructive cyclical crisis after the Great Depression of the late 1920s and early 1930s; the cyclical crisis of 2020, which coincided with the COVID-19 pandemic and had a fairly negative impact on the US economy and revealed its weaknesses; and finally, inflation, which in 2022 hit 8% for the first time in 40 years. |
